Key Financial Performance

Adjusted EBITDA $27 million on sales of $343.8 million in the first quarter, representing a 7% increase compared to the prior year. The increase is attributed to the early benefits of Project Apollo transformation initiatives and operational excellence.

Gross Margin Improved 200 basis points to 27.9% versus the prior year, driven by Apollo savings from plant consolidation and improved product mix.

Net Sales Declined 5.2% to $343.8 million, primarily due to a $18 million decline in the bakery business as part of a focus on higher-margin opportunities. $13 million of this decline was related to SKU optimization efforts under Project Apollo.

Food Service Segment Net Sales Declined $19.7 million or 8.3% to $219.2 million, with $18 million of the decline attributed to lower-margin bakery business reflecting steps to improve product mix.

Retail Segment Net Sales Increased $1.2 million or 2.6% to $45.9 million, driven by a $1.8 million increase in handheld volume due to recovery from last year's capacity constraints caused by a facility fire.

Frozen Beverage Net Sales Materially flat at $78.7 million, with modest increases in beverage sales offset by slight declines in service and machine sales.

Operating Expenses Increased to $95.4 million, including $6.1 million in nonrecurring plant closure costs and other impacts. Selling and marketing expenses rose 9.9% or $2.8 million, driven by higher commissions, brand investments, and depreciation.

Adjusted Operating Income $8 million compared to $8.2 million in the prior year, reflecting stable performance.

Adjusted Earnings Per Share $0.33, in line with the prior year, despite onetime charges impacting reported earnings per share.

Operating Cash Flow Generated approximately $36 million during the quarter, with $19 million invested in capital expenditures.

Operating Highlights

New product launches: Several new products are set to be shipped in Q2, including protein and whole-grain pretzels, Luigi mini pops with hydration and immunity benefits, Dippin' Dots Sunday flavor extensions, and traditional Dippin' Dots for retail.

Frozen novelties: Dogsters volume grew over 20% in Q1, with a new item launched late in Q1 and another launching in Q2.

Retail and theater expansion: Dippin' Dots sales grew approximately 4% in Q1, driven by retail growth, theater expansion, and amusement centers.

Convenience and QSR expansion: ICEE expanded to a large Southwest convenience store operator and is testing with a major West Coast QSR operator.

Project Apollo transformation: Achieved $3 million in net savings in Q1, with plant consolidation on track for full implementation in Q2. Expected $20 million run rate operating income once fully activated.

Gross margin improvement: Gross margin improved by 200 basis points to 27.9%, driven by Apollo savings and improved product mix.

Portfolio optimization: Focused on higher-margin opportunities, leading to a 5.2% decline in net sales, with $13 million attributed to SKU optimization.

Share repurchase: Completed $42 million share repurchase in Q1 and announced a new $50 million repurchase authorization.

Risk or Challenges

Net Sales Decline: Net sales declined by 5.2% to $343.8 million, primarily due to a focus on higher-margin opportunities and SKU optimization efforts. This decline is expected to continue, representing an approximate 3% drop in sales for fiscal 2026.

Government Shutdown and SNAP Benefits: Sales were negatively impacted by the government shutdown and the pause in SNAP benefits, particularly affecting frozen novelties.

Product Disposal Costs: The company incurred $1 million in unfavorable product disposal costs during the quarter.

Tariff-Related Costs: Tariff-related costs amounted to approximately $600,000, with some impact expected to persist through fiscal 2026.

Nonrecurring Costs: Operating expenses increased due to $6.1 million in nonrecurring plant closure costs and other impacts, with an additional $5 million in transformation project costs anticipated for fiscal 2026.

Increased Selling and Marketing Expenses: Selling and marketing expenses rose by 9.9%, driven by higher commissions, brand investments, and depreciation costs, which could pressure margins.

Frozen Beverage Segment: Frozen beverage net sales were flat, with modest growth in beverage sales offset by declines in service and machine sales.

Box Office Performance: Disappointing box office performance in the fiscal first quarter, with an estimated 10% decline compared to the prior year, impacted related sales.

Guidance & Outlook

Portfolio Optimization: The company expects portfolio optimization to result in an approximate 3% decline in sales for fiscal 2026.

Project Apollo: The company remains confident in achieving $20 million of run rate operating income once all initiatives are activated. Plant consolidation is on track to be fully implemented during the fiscal second quarter.

Innovation Pipeline: Several new products are planned for Q2, including protein and whole-grain pretzels, Luigi mini pops with hydration and immunity benefits, Dippin' Dots Sunday flavor extensions, and the launch of traditional Dippin' Dots for retail.

Theater Performance: The company is optimistic about theater performance for the balance of fiscal 2026, supported by promising movie titles such as Super Mario Galaxy, Minions 3, and Spider-Man: Brand-new Day.

Tariff Impact: Some tariff-related costs are expected to subside over the course of fiscal 2026.

Nonrecurring Costs: Additional nonrecurring transformation project costs of approximately $5 million are expected in fiscal 2026.

Summer Season Investments: Investments in preparation for the peak summer season are expected to generate growth during that period.

Key Q&A

Q:How is the company addressing the 3% headwind from SKU rationalization and what is the expected sales growth for the year?
A:The company is addressing the 3% headwind from SKU rationalization through portfolio optimization and plant consolidations. Despite this, they expect low single-digit growth for the year, supported by new business and innovation.
Q:What progress has been made on Project Apollo and when will the $20 million annual run rate be achieved?
A:Project Apollo has delivered $3 million in cost savings in Q1. The $20 million annual run rate is expected to be achieved in Q2, with $15 million from plant consolidations and the remaining $5 million from distribution and G&A savings by Q4.
Q:What is the current state of the commodity environment and its impact on gross margins?
A:The commodity environment is expected to be more favorable this year compared to last year, particularly for cocoa and eggs. Gross margins improved by 200 basis points in Q1, driven by plant consolidation, new business, and portfolio mix. A $1 million product disposal cost impacted Q1 gross profit but is not expected to recur.
